I think i blew up my t-56! HELP!

OK, so im going down the road at about 35 and i ease into the pedal to get up to 40. and i hear this Horrable clunking. SO i pull off with my g/f. Get out of my car and look around underneath thinking i hit something, or somethings stuck up there. (mind you its about 10pm so its dark) nothing.. So i start to go again.. first gear feels fine till i get to 2k. makes the Horable clunk and some other smaller hitting sounds.. and it feels like its in the trans or close to it. I can feel the clunk in the shifter i think(dont remeber now cuz ive played it through my head so much) Im thinking it might be a mount or my driveshaft. How can i check my driveshaft. This is sucky, i cant drive the thing. What can i check for and what other info can i give you too help me on my escapade.. i dont think its the trans (well i hope not)... any ideas?

Just to clarify the Bulletproof thing...you have a 93...which is a good bit weaker than the 94-97 version. I think yours is rated at 330 lb-ft of torque vs. 94-97 450. But that does sound kinda like a tranny mount.
